Chicago fitting

A Chicago fitting (also called a Duck's foot fitting due to its shape) is a one quarter turn fitting or hose coupling used for attaching hoses or piping together. Chicago fittings are used on both low to medium pressure gas and fluid lines.[1] The advantages of the Chicago fitting are that they can be used in a wide range of industries and that there are no male or female fitting; both fittings are identical. A Chicago fitting is also known as an Air King coupling.
